Demystifying AI Reporting

The AI Spotlight Series, led by Karen Hao, aims to equip journalists with the knowledge and tools needed to cover artificial intelligence effectively and responsibly. This initiative addresses the challenges of reporting on AI, including the complexity of the technology and the difficulty in separating fact from hype.

Key Aspects of the Program:

  • Provides a comprehensive understanding of AI’s capabilities and limitations
  • Teaches journalists to ask critical questions about AI development and applications
  • Highlights common pitfalls in AI reporting, such as anthropomorphizing AI systems
  • Emphasizes the importance of focusing on human stories and impacts

Why It Matters

As AI continues to reshape society, accurate and nuanced reporting becomes crucial. The AI Spotlight Series empowers journalists to cut through the hype, ask probing questions, and uncover meaningful stories about AI’s real-world impacts. By improving the quality of AI journalism, this initiative aims to foster a more informed public discourse on this transformative technology.
